Direct Surface Mounting (Indoor Only) - Figure 2
NOTE:
The installer should use suitable hardware

appropriate for the installation.

1. Insert a small flat blade screwdriver between the locking

mechanism and the lens. Gently push down and then

pry up, unseating the lens. Pull the lens up and off of

the signal mounting base, being careful not to damage

the internal circuit.

2.

Setting the Flash Pattern: The 48XBRM Series Visual

Indicator is supplied with a default setting of steady-on.

If flashing (65 fpm) is desired, set dipswitch as shown in

Figure 4.

3. Remove the two knockouts for mounting screws from

the signal base. Place the 3-3/4" (95mm) mounting

gasket provided in the direct surface mounting kit on

the mounting surface and mark the center of the three

holes in the gasket on the mounting surface. Remove

the gasket and drill a 3/8" (10mm) hole at each of the

marked positions.

4. Install the two rubber expansion plugs provided in the

hardware kit into the two outer holes in the mounting

surface.

5. Route the wire leads from the signal base through the

center hole in both the mounting gasket and surface. The

wiring should be run through an approved raceway or

conduit connected between the bottom of the signal base

and an approved junction box (not supplied). Bring wire

leads into the junction box. Refer to the signal's label for

voltage rating.

6. Align the outer holes in the mounting gasket with the

holes in the surface. Insert two screws with lockwashers

through the two outer holes in the signal base and align

the screws with the rubber expansion plugs as shown

in Figure 2. Press the signal base firmly against the

mounting surface and tighten the screws.

7. Carefully place the lens back on the unit and snap in

place.

8. Connect the field wiring to the signal wire leads as

described in the Wiring Section.

Wiring

1. For AC models, use wire nuts (not supplied) and connect

the signal's black and white wire leads to the power

source wires. Polarity is not important.

2. For DC models, connect the signal's red wire to the

positive power source wire and connect the signal's black

wire to the negative power source using appropriate

connectors (not supplied). Polarity must be observed.
